Sophie

Sophie

distrib > * > 2008.0 > x86_64 > by-pkgid > 2a1f9f594badeaf40e683bc824fd4eed > files > 1

cw-1.0.14-3mdv2007.1.src.rpm

--- cw-1.0.14/Makefile.in.build	2005-09-26 04:27:57.000000000 +0200
+++ cw-1.0.14/Makefile.in	2006-11-04 03:22:49.000000000 +0100
@@ -31,16 +31,16 @@
 	@$(ECHO) "* Installing color wrapper locally..."
 	@$(MKDIR) -m 755 $(HOME)/.cw $(HOME)/.cw/bin $(HOME)/.cw/def\
         $(HOME)/.cw/def/etc
-	@for FILE in bin/*;do\
+	@for FILE in bin/*;do \
 	$(INSTALL) -m 755 $$FILE $(HOME)/.cw/bin/;\
 	done
 	@$(LN) -sf $(HOME)/.cw/bin/cw $(HOME)/.cw/bin/cwe
 	@$(ECHO) "* Installing color wrapper generic definition files..."
-	@for FILE in def/*;do\
+	@for FILE in def/*;do \
 	$(INSTALL) -m 755 $$FILE $(HOME)/.cw/def/;\
 	done
 	@$(ECHO) "* Installing color wrapper generic header/footer files..."
-	@for FILE in etc/*;do\
+	@for FILE in etc/*;do \
 	$(INSTALL) -m 644 $$FILE $(HOME)/.cw/def/etc/;\
 	done
 	@$(ECHO) "* Updating definition files..."
@@ -61,28 +61,29 @@
 	@$(ECHO) "* PLEASE view the ./README file for more information if"\
         "you haven't already."
 
-install: cleanpub cw cwu
+install: cw cwu
 	@$(ECHO) "* Installing color wrapper..."
-	@for FILE in bin/*;do\
-	$(INSTALL) -o 0 -g 0 -m 755 $$FILE $(BINDIR);\
+	$(MKDIR) -p -m 755 $(DESTDIR)$(BINDIR); $(MKDIR) -p -m 755 $(DESTDIR)$(MANDIR)/man1
+	@for FILE in bin/*;do \
+	$(INSTALL) -m 755 $$FILE $(DESTDIR)$(BINDIR);\
 	done
-	@$(LN) -sf $(BINDIR)/cw $(BINDIR)/cwe
+	@(cd $(DESTDIR)$(BINDIR) && $(LN) -sf cw cwe)
 	@$(ECHO) "* Installing color wrapper generic definition files..."
-	@$(MKDIR) -m 755 $(LIBDIR)/cw/
-	@for FILE in def/*;do\
-	$(INSTALL) -o 0 -g 0 -m 755 $$FILE $(LIBDIR)/cw/;\
+	@$(MKDIR) -p -m 755 $(DESTDIR)$(LIBDIR)/cw/
+	@for FILE in def/*;do \
+	$(INSTALL) -m 755 $$FILE $(DESTDIR)$(LIBDIR)/cw/;\
 	done
 	@$(ECHO) "* Installing color wrapper generic header/footer files..."
-	@$(MKDIR) -m 755 $(LIBDIR)/cw/etc
-	@for FILE in etc/*;do\
-	$(INSTALL) -o 0 -g 0 -m 644 $$FILE $(LIBDIR)/cw/etc;\
+	@$(MKDIR) -p -m 755 $(DESTDIR)$(LIBDIR)/cw/etc
+	@for FILE in etc/*;do \
+	$(INSTALL) -m 644 $$FILE $(DESTDIR)$(LIBDIR)/cw/etc;\
 	done
 	@$(ECHO) "* Installing manual pages..."
-	@for FILE in man/*;do\
-	$(INSTALL) -o 0 -g 0 -m 644 $$FILE $(MANDIR)/man1/;\
+	@for FILE in man/*;do \
+	$(INSTALL) -m 644 $$FILE $(DESTDIR)$(MANDIR)/man1/;\
 	done
 	@$(ECHO) "* Updating definition files..."
-	@$(BINDIR)/cwu $(LIBDIR)/cw $(BINDIR)/cw
+	@$(DESTDIR)$(BINDIR)/cwu $(DESTDIR)$(LIBDIR)/cw  $(DESTDIR)$(BINDIR)/cw
 	@$(ECHO) "-----------------------------------------------------------"
 	@$(ECHO) "* Complete, definitions are stored in: $(LIBDIR)/cw"
 	@$(ECHO) "* For bash: place 'export PATH=\"$(LIBDIR)/cw:\$$PATH\"'"\
@@ -95,7 +96,7 @@
         "\"color\" command, or the environmental variable NOCOLOR=1 to turn"\
         "color wrapping on and off."
 	@$(ECHO) ""
-	@$(ECHO) "* PLEASE view the ./README file for more information if"\
+	@$(ECHO) "* PLEASE view the README file for more information if"\
         "you haven't already."
 
 clean: